Multidisciplinary approach to transvenous lead extraction: a single center's experience
Timothy M Maus1, Jesse Shurter1, Liem Nguyen1
1Sulpizio Cardiovascular Center; University of California San Diego, La Jolla, California.
Transvenous lead extraction is safe with a multidisciplinary team approach. This strategy improved success rates and reduced major complications in patients requiring lead removal.
Area of Science:
- Cardiology
- Cardiac Surgery
- Electrophysiology
Background:
- Transvenous lead extraction is a critical procedure for managing complications associated with implanted cardiac electronic devices.
- Indications for lead extraction commonly include lead malfunction and infection.
- A multidisciplinary approach may enhance procedural safety and efficacy.
Purpose of the Study:
- To evaluate the success and complication rates of a single center's multidisciplinary approach to transvenous lead extraction.
- To assess the impact of a collaborative team on managing patients undergoing lead extraction.
Main Methods:
- A retrospective case series of 351 transvenous lead extractions in 195 patients over 42 months at a university hospital.
- Involved a multidisciplinary team including cardiac surgery, electrophysiology, perfusion, and cardiac anesthesiology.
- Tracked indications, success rates, and complication rates.
Main Results:
- The overall lead extraction rate was 99.7%, with complete removal in 97.7%.
- Major indications included lead malfunction (53.3%) and infection (36.9%).
- The initial major complication rate of 3.08% decreased to 1.23% after the first year, indicating a learning curve and improved outcomes.
Conclusions:
- Transvenous lead extraction is a generally safe procedure, though complications can occur.
- A multidisciplinary approach facilitates successful lead extraction and effective management of major complications.
- This collaborative strategy appears to improve patient outcomes and procedural safety over time.
